How Does Organic Cotton Bedding Contribute to Sustainability?

Organic cotton bedding contributes to sustainability through various environmentally friendly practices and benefits.

  • Non-Toxic Farming Practices: Organic cotton is grown without synthetic pesticides and fertilizers, which helps protect the ecosystem and the health of farmers. This method promotes biodiversity and reduces the chemical runoff that can pollute water sources.
  • Water Conservation: Organic cotton farming generally uses less water compared to conventional methods. This is achieved through practices like rain-fed irrigation and soil health management, which enhance the soil’s ability to retain moisture.
  • Soil Health Improvement: Organic farming techniques, such as crop rotation and composting, contribute to healthier soil. Healthy soil not only supports plant growth but also sequesters carbon, which helps mitigate climate change.
  • Reduced Carbon Footprint: The absence of synthetic chemicals and the use of sustainable farming practices in organic cotton production lead to lower greenhouse gas emissions. Additionally, organic cotton is often produced locally, reducing transportation emissions.
  • Biodegradability: Organic cotton bedding is made from natural fibers, making it biodegradable at the end of its life cycle. This means it can decompose naturally without contributing to landfill waste or environmental pollution.
  • Fair Labor Practices: Many organic cotton brands prioritize ethical labor practices, ensuring fair wages and safe working conditions for farmers and workers. This commitment to social responsibility aligns with the broader principles of sustainability.

What Care Tips Will Help Maintain the Quality of Organic Cotton Bedding?

To maintain the quality of organic cotton bedding, consider the following care tips:

  • Wash in Cold Water: Washing organic cotton bedding in cold water helps preserve its fabric integrity and color vibrancy. Hot water can cause shrinkage and fade the natural dyes used in organic cotton.
  • Avoid Harsh Detergents: Use mild, eco-friendly detergents that do not contain bleach or synthetic fragrances. These harsh chemicals can break down the fibers over time and reduce the softness and durability of the bedding.
  • Line Dry or Use Low Heat: Air drying is the gentlest method for drying organic cotton bedding, helping to prevent wear and tear. If using a dryer, opt for a low heat setting to minimize shrinkage and maintain the fabric’s quality.
  • Iron on Low Heat: If wrinkles occur, use a low heat setting when ironing organic cotton sheets. High temperatures can damage the fibers, so it’s best to keep the heat minimal to maintain their softness and structure.
  • Store Properly: Store your organic cotton bedding in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This prevents fading and protects the fibers from moisture and pests, ensuring they remain in top condition for longer.
  • Rotate Bedding Regularly: Regularly rotating your bedding helps to distribute wear evenly and prolongs the life of each piece. This practice also allows each set to recover and maintain its shape and softness between uses.
